A1 Expression 中性

Unasema Kiingereza?

Do you speak English?

意思

Asking if someone knows the English language.

🌍

文化背景

In Tanzania, Swahili is the primary national language. While many speak English, starting with Swahili is highly appreciated and seen as a sign of respect for the nation's identity. In Kenya, English and Swahili are both official languages. You will often hear 'Sheng', a mix of the two. Asking 'Unasema Kiingereza?' is common but people might switch between languages mid-sentence. Zanzibar is the heart of 'pure' Swahili (Kiunguja). People here are very proud of their language. Using polite forms like 'Je, unasema...' is recommended. In Uganda, English is very widely spoken as a first or second language. Swahili is used but often in specific contexts like trade or security. You might find more people answering 'Yes' here than in rural Tanzania.

💡

Always greet first

Say 'Habari' or 'Hujambo' before asking. It opens doors much faster.

🎯

Use 'Kidogo'

Adding 'kidogo' (a little) makes the question less intimidating for the other person.

意思

Asking if someone knows the English language.

💡

Always greet first

Say 'Habari' or 'Hujambo' before asking. It opens doors much faster.

🎯

Use 'Kidogo'

Adding 'kidogo' (a little) makes the question less intimidating for the other person.

💬

The 'Je' factor

Using 'Je' at the start makes you sound very educated and polite.

自我测试

Choose the correct way to ask 'Do you speak English?' to an elder.

Which one is the most respectful?

✓ 正确! ✗ 不太对。 正确答案: b

Starting with 'Shikamoo' is the standard way to show respect to elders in Swahili culture.

Fill in the missing prefix for the language.

Unasema ___ingereza?

✓ 正确! ✗ 不太对。 正确答案: Ki

The 'Ki-' prefix is used for all languages in Swahili.

Complete the dialogue.

Traveler: Samahani, unasema Kiingereza? Local: _____, kidogo tu.

✓ 正确! ✗ 不太对。 正确答案: Ndiyo

'Ndiyo' means 'Yes', which fits the context of 'a little bit'.

Match the Swahili to the English.

Match the following:

✓ 正确! ✗ 不太对。 正确答案: a

All pairs are correctly matched.

🎉 得分: /4

视觉学习工具

Formal vs Informal

Informal
Unasema Kiingereza? Do you speak English?
Formal
Je, mnasema Kiingereza? Do you (plural/respectful) speak English?

练习题库

4 练习
Choose the correct way to ask 'Do you speak English?' to an elder. Choose A1

Which one is the most respectful?

✓ 正确! ✗ 不太对。 正确答案: b

Starting with 'Shikamoo' is the standard way to show respect to elders in Swahili culture.

Fill in the missing prefix for the language. Fill Blank A1

Unasema ___ingereza?

✓ 正确! ✗ 不太对。 正确答案: Ki

The 'Ki-' prefix is used for all languages in Swahili.

Complete the dialogue. dialogue_completion A1

Traveler: Samahani, unasema Kiingereza? Local: _____, kidogo tu.

✓ 正确! ✗ 不太对。 正确答案: Ndiyo

'Ndiyo' means 'Yes', which fits the context of 'a little bit'.

Match the Swahili to the English. Match A2

将左侧的每个项目与右侧的配对匹配:

✓ 正确! ✗ 不太对。 正确答案: a

All pairs are correctly matched.

🎉 得分: /4

常见问题

10 个问题

No, but it can be if you don't greet the person first. Always start with 'Habari'.

'Unasema' means 'you speak', while 'unajua' means 'you know'. They are used interchangeably in this context.

The 'Ki-' prefix is required for all languages in Swahili. 'Ingereza' is the country.

In casual settings (Sheng), yes, but 'Kiingereza' is the correct Swahili word.

You say 'Nasema Kiingereza kidogo'.

No, it's optional. It just makes the question more formal.

Use 'Mnasema Kiingereza?'.

Yes, especially in cities and tourist areas, but Swahili is the main language.

It's pronounced kee-een-gay-RAY-zah.

Usually 'Ndiyo' (Yes) or 'Hapana' (No).

相关表达

🔗

Unajua Kiingereza?

similar

Do you know English?

🔗

Unasema Kiswahili?

similar

Do you speak Swahili?

🔗

Naweza kusema Kiingereza?

builds on

Can I speak English?

🔗

Sema polepole

related

Speak slowly

有帮助吗?
还没有评论。成为第一个分享想法的人!